Some novel intron positions in conserved Drosophila genes are caused by intron sliding or tandem duplication
BACKGROUND: Positions of spliceosomal introns are often conserved between remotely related genes. Introns that reside in non-conserved positions are either novel or remnants of frequent losses of introns in some evolutionary lineages. A recent gain of such introns is difficult to prove.
